Bettiah Subdivision - Pashchim Champaran, Bihar
Bettiah is an administrative subdivision in the Pashchim Champaran district of Bihar, India. It includes various villages governed through Gram Panchayats and forms part of the district's rural administration. The nearest railway station is situated at Bettiah, while the nearest airport is Raxaul Airport, located at an approximate aerial distance of 28.3 km.
According to the 2011 Census, the total area of the subdivision was 68 km², including 58.29 km² of rural area and 9.84 km² of urban area. The sex ratio was 904 females per 1,000 males.

Population of Bettiah Subdivision
According to the 2011 Census, Bettiah Subdivision had a total population of 2,24,200 people living in 41,133 households. The population comprised 1,17,771 males and 1,06,429 females, with an average population density of 3,291 people per km². The table below provides a rural-urban comparison of these statistics.
| Category | Total | Rural | Urban |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 2,24,200 | 75,545 | 1,48,655 |
| Male Population | 1,17,771 | 39,588 | 78,183 |
| Female Population | 1,06,429 | 35,957 | 70,472 |
| Total Households | 41,133 | 13,649 | 27,484 |
| Population Density | 3,291 / km² | 1,296 / km² | 15,107 / km² |
Bettiah Subdivision had 1,39,967 literate people and 36,604 children in the 0–6 age group. Scheduled Caste (SC) and Scheduled Tribe (ST) populations were 21,265 and 2,280 respectively. The table below presents their rural and urban distribution.
| Category | Total | Rural | Urban |
|---|---|---|---|
| Child Population (Age 0–6) | 36,604 | 14,695 | 21,909 |
| Literate Population | 1,39,967 | 38,976 | 1,00,991 |
| Illiterate Population | 84,233 | 36,569 | 47,664 |
| Scheduled Caste (SC) Population | 21,265 | 11,770 | 9,495 |
| Scheduled Tribe (ST) Population | 2,280 | 1,154 | 1,126 |
NOTE: Population and area figures shown here are based on Census 2011. Administrative boundaries may have changed, so the figures may include combined values for areas that were reorganized later.
